]> git.pld-linux.org Git - packages/guitarix.git/blame - glib2.68.patch
fix build with glib2 >= 2.68 (from gentoo)
[packages/guitarix.git] / glib2.68.patch
CommitLineData
b5878a85
JP
1diff --git a/src/headers/gx_system.h b/src/headers/gx_system.h
2index d334ecfc..88d97567 100644
3--- a/src/headers/gx_system.h
4+++ b/src/headers/gx_system.h
5@@ -132,7 +132,7 @@ inline T *atomic_get(T*& p) {
6
7 template <class T>
8 inline bool atomic_compare_and_exchange(T **p, T *oldv, T *newv) {
9- return g_atomic_pointer_compare_and_exchange(reinterpret_cast<void* volatile*>(p), static_cast<void*>(oldv), newv);
10+ return g_atomic_pointer_compare_and_exchange(reinterpret_cast<void**>(p), static_cast<void*>(oldv), newv);
11 }
12
13
This page took 0.733975 seconds and 4 git commands to generate.